For example, registering for a webinar or an in-house educational seminar differs greatly from the registration process for a multi-day user conference. Your event registration platform of choice may also need to provide the flexibility to create separate, optional add-on sessions such as gala dinners or pre-conference education sessions.

Hosts can send requests to listeners to become speakers, or listeners can request permission to speak by tapping on the “Request” icon. Hosts can mute a speaker or all speakers at once or remove them from the space completely. Stage moderators are special speakers who can set a topic on the Stage Channel and open it.
